It's understandable that Rangers fans think we don't like him because of last season but he was (often unfairly) disliked for most of his time here. In the first season he failed to replace Coutts and we had to bring Lee Evans in. Second season he started 5 games and even Basham was in midfield ahead of him in certain games. Third season he has a phenomenal 3 month period before losing his place post Christmas to Besic and then Berge. 4th season he was poor in the early stages(as were the rest of the team) before becoming a complete joke by the end.

In 4 seasons he had no more than 20 decent games. He was a nothing player for the vast majority of his time here and he was never going to get a Premier League club after leaving.

I gave him the benefit of the doubt until the Leeds game on the 5th April 2021. I couldn't believe his lack of effort trying to get back as Leeds broke away. Ampadu who had started way behind him raced past him as recorded in this report:-

What happened next proved the final straw for many Sheffield United fans.
With Leeds breaking at their customary pace, and John Fleck losing his footing, they had a three-on-two situation. Lundstram was the nearest Blades player to the ball and Raphinha; Ben Osborn and Rhian Brewster were racing back to cover.
Ethan Ampadu, the United defender, was in the Leeds area when the free-kick came in and by the time Raphinha raced clear, was at least 15 yards further up the pitch than Lundstram. Within three seconds, he had caught his teammate up and a few moments later was in a position to almost cut out the Brazilian’s cross, which Stuart Dallas put narrowly wide.
